Key Parameters and Design Philosophy
At its core, this chain ring is engineered for Bafang’s popular BBS01 and BBS02 mid-drive motors, which are widely used in e-bike conversions and commuter builds. The 42-tooth configuration strikes a balance between torque and cadence efficiency, making it suitable for urban commuting, light trail use, or touring. Constructed from 6061-T6 aluminium alloy, the chain ring prioritises durability without compromising on weight—a critical consideration for e-bike setups where motor strain and component longevity are paramount.

The offset correction feature is a standout design element. Many aftermarket chain rings for Bafang systems struggle with chainline alignment, leading to premature chain wear or noisy operation. Snowchecking’s solution incorporates a calculated offset to correct this misalignment, ensuring smoother engagement across gears. Riders have noted that this adjustment reduces “chain slap” and improves shifting consistency, particularly when paired with 6-9-speed drivetrains.

Considerations for Prospective Buyers
While overwhelmingly positive, a small subset of feedback highlights the importance of precise installation. The offset correction relies on proper alignment with the motor’s mounting interface, and rushed installations may negate its benefits. Consulting Bafang’s torque specifications and using thread-locking compounds on bolts is advised—a standard practice for any drivetrain component but worth reiterating here.

Additionally, riders accustomed to larger chain rings (e.g., 46T or 48T) should evaluate their gear ratios carefully. The 42T configuration favours climbing efficiency, which may necessitate higher cadences on flat terrain. That said, this aligns well with the natural torque curve of Bafang motors, which excel in low-to-mid RPM scenarios.
